What is a Zip Code and Why is it Important for Big Bear Lake?
A Zip Code (Zone Improvement Plan) is a system of postal codes used by the United States Postal Service (USPS) since 1963. It consists of a five-digit numeric code, and sometimes an extended nine-digit code (ZIP+4), that identifies a geographic area for mail sorting and delivery. The primary goal of the zip code system is to increase the efficiency and speed of mail distribution.
For a place like Big Bear Lake, which is a popular tourist destination and a year-round community, zip codes play several crucial roles:
- Accurate Mail Delivery: This is the most obvious function. Correct zip codes ensure that letters, packages, and any other mail reach the intended recipients without delay or getting lost.
- Shipping and Logistics: Online shopping and shipping services rely heavily on zip codes to calculate shipping costs, delivery times, and to route packages correctly. For businesses operating in or shipping to Big Bear Lake, this is critical.
- Emergency Services: While 911 is the universal emergency number, specific location data, often aided by zip codes, helps emergency responders pinpoint exact locations faster, which is vital in mountainous or spread-out areas.
- Local Service Providers: Many local services, from utility companies to repair technicians and delivery drivers, use zip codes to define their service areas and estimate travel times.
- Demographic and Statistical Data: Zip codes are often used by government agencies and researchers to gather demographic information, conduct surveys, and analyze economic trends within specific areas.
- Online Forms and Registrations: When filling out online forms for addresses, schools, or services, having the correct zip code is usually a mandatory field.

The Primary Zip Code for Big Bear Lake
The main zip code serving the incorporated City of Big Bear Lake is 92315. This code covers a significant portion of the area surrounding the lake, including:
- The City of Big Bear Lake itself.
- Many of the popular lodges, hotels, and cabins.
- Key commercial areas along Big Bear Boulevard.
- Access points to the lake for recreational activities.
